2 The dollar equivalents of these loans are computed for reporting purposes at varying rates. If the loan agreements stipulate a dollar denominated figure, the loans outstanding are generally valued at the agreement rates of exchange. Loans executed in units of foreign currency are valued at the market rates (Le., the rates of exchange at which the Treasury sells such currencies to Government agencies).

NOTE. The loan account/expenditure account distinction was discontinued in the fiscal year 1972 parsuant to the Office of Management and Budget Circular No. A-11, Revised, dated June 12, 1972, but is being shown here for users' convenience for the last time. Data formerly classified in the loan account is still published monthly in the Treasury Bulletin while the need for such data is being assessed.

This table excludes interagency loans. The Treasury Bulletin for November 1972 contained on pp. 125–171, statistical statements of financial condition by agencies as of June 30, 1972. Statements of income and expense, and source and application of funds by agencies as of June 30, 1972, were published in the Treasury Bulletin for December 1972.

1 This Association was created effective Sept. 30, 1968, by an act approved Aug. 1, 1968 (12 U.S.C. 1716b). It retained the assets and liabilities of the previously existing corporation accounted for under 12 U.S.C. 1720 and 1721 and will continue to operate the functions authorized by these two sections.
